The Evolution of Slot Mechanics
Bodoni video slots have moved far beyond the simple three-reel, single-payline machines of the past. Today’s titles unified a dizzying regalia of mechanics designed to keep gameplay unused and engaging. One of the most influential innovations has been the Megaways engine, originally developed by Big Time Gaming. This mechanic randomly changes the number of symbols appearing on each reel during every spin, resulting in thousands of potential ways to win—sometimes up to 117,649 or more. Games similar Bonanza and Extra Chilli popularised this format, and it has since been licensed by numerous studios. The appeal lies in the unpredictability: no two spins experience the same, and the sheer volume of paylines can lead to explosive winning combinations. Another major trend is the Hold & Win mechanic, often found in games by Light & Wonder. In these slots, landing a special bonus symbol triggers a respin feature where other symbols lock in place, and only if new bonus symbols appear. Each new one resets the respin counter, offering the potential to take the entire grid for a jackpot prize. This simple yet addictive loop-the-loop has made games ilk Dragon Link and Dollar Storm perennial favourites in both land-based and online casinos. Cluster Pays mechanics, popularised by NetEnt’s Aloha! Cluster Pays, offer another departure from traditional paylines. Instead of matching symbols on fixed lines, wins are awarded for clusters of adjacent symbols, often with cascading or tumbling reels. This means winning symbols go away and new ones fall into localize, potentially creating chain reactions of wins from a single spin. The combination of cluster pays with cascading symbols creates a dynamic, fast-paced experience that can yield substantial multipliers as the wins accumulate. These nucleus mechanics have become staples in the industry, forming the foundation for countless innovative slot titles.
Bonus Buy and Volatility Considerations
The introduction of the Bonus Buy feature has been a game-changer for players who prefer direct access to a slot’s bonus round of drinks. Instead of waiting for scatter symbols to trigger free spins or other features organically, players can pay a fixed multiple of their bet—often 50x to 100x—to instantly enter the bonus game. This mechanic is particularly popular in high-volatility slots where the base game selection can be relatively uneventful but the bonus rounds offer monolithic win potential. Games like Sweet Bonanza and Gates of Olympus have embraced this feature, allowing players to skip the grind and go straight to the action. However, it’s important for players to understand that Bonus Buy options typically come with higher volatility, import the cost can be significant and wins are not guaranteed. Some jurisdictions, including the UK, have regulations around the visibility and advancement of Bonus Buy features, so players should ever check the terms. Expanding reels interpret another engaging mechanic, often tied to bonus rounds or progressive features. In these slots, the reel grid expands during certain phases, adding additional rows or columns to increase winning possibilities. For instance, some games start with a standard 5×3 gridiron but expand to 5×6 or more during free spins, dramatically boosting the number of ways to win. This visual enlargement adds excitement and can lead to significantly larger payouts. The interplay between volatility, RTP, and these mechanics is crucial: a high-volatility slot with expanding reels and a Bonus Buy option might offer life-changing jackpots but also carries higher risk. Players should always check the game’s RTP and volatility rating before committing real money, especially when using features similar Bonus Buy that increase the cost per spin.
Cascading Reels and Multipliers
Cascading reels, also known as tumbling or avalanche reels, have become a hallmark of modern slot design. Instead of spinning reels stopping with winning combinations highlighted, the winning symbols explode or disappear, and new symbols devolve from higher up to make full the gaps. This allows for consecutive wins from a single spin, often with increasing multipliers applied to from each one cascade. The mechanic is magnetic core to many popular titles, including the Megaways series and games like Reactoonz. The multiplier aspect is particularly compelling: some slots start with a 1x multiplier on the first win, increasing by 1x with each subsequent cascade, while others go for random multipliers to individual winning clusters. This can lead to exponential growth in payouts during a single spin. For example, in a game similar Jammin’ Jars, apiece cascade increases the multiplier up to a maximum, turning a modest starting win into a substantial reward. The combination of cascading reels and multipliers creates a sensation of momentum and expectancy, as each win fuels the potential for an even bigger one. Some slots also incorporate progressive multipliers that remain throughout the entire bonus round, resetting only when the feature ends. This mechanic is particularly effective in high-volatility games where the base game may be quiet but the bonus rounds can produce massive wins. Additionally, the visual feedback of symbols exploding and new ones dropping keeps the player engaged, making each spin feel ilk a mini-event. For UK players, understanding how cascading reels and multipliers interact is key to choosing games that correspond their risk tolerance and play style.

Getting to Grips with Megaways and Expanding Reels
Megaways is one of the most recognisable mechanics in modern font slots, and it’s easy to see why it has become so popular with Kiwi players. Instead of a fixed list of paylines, a Megaways game uses a random reel modifier that changes the figure of symbols appearing on each reel with every spin. This can result in hundreds of thousands of ways to win — often up to 117,649 — which keeps every spin feeling impudent and unpredictable. The mechanic was originally developed by Big Time Gaming and has been licensed to many other studios, so you’ll find Megaways titles across a wide chain of mountains of themes, from ancient history to fantasy worlds. The cay thing to read is that the number of symbols on each reel is determined randomly, and the total ways to win is calculated by multiplying the number of symbols on each reel. For example, if you have six reels with varying symbolization counts, the total ways can skyrocket. This means that even a modest bet can lead to significant payouts when the reels adjust in your favour. Expanding reels are another feature that adds depth to slot gameplay. Unlike Megaways, where the symbolisation calculate changes randomly, expanding reels typically increase the number of rows during a bonus round or when certain symbols land. This can happen in a variety of ways: a full reel of a special symbol might expand to cover the full reel, or a bonus trigger mightiness supply an duplicate row to the grid. For instance, in some games, landing a bonus symbol on the middle reels will cause the entire reel to expand, giving you thomas more chances to hit a winning combination. This mechanic is often combined with other features, such as free spins or multipliers, to create a more engaging experience. For New Zealand players, it’s worth noting that many of these games are available at online casinos that hold a licence from the Department of Internal Affairs, which is the regulatory body for gambling in New Zealand. When you play a Megaways or expanding reel slot, you should always confirm the paytable to understand how the feature workings, as the specifics can motley from game to offering. Some Megaways games might feature a minimum of two symbols per reel, while others might have a minimum of triplet, and this can significantly affect your chances of hitting a big win. Expanding reels, on the other hand, are often tied to the game’s main bonus feature, so you’ll want to initiation that feature to see the real potential. Overall, both mechanics are designed to append excitement and variety to the base game selection, and they are a liberal reason why slot players in New Zealand keep coming back for more.
Hold & Win and the Allure of Collecting Symbols
Hold & Win is a popular feature that has become a staple in many slot games, especially those with a classic or Mediterranean theme. The basic premise is simple: during the bonus round, you are presented with a mark of reels, and your goal is to collect special symbols that carry coin values or jackpot prizes. The feature starts with a certain figure of spins, usually three, and every time a special symbol lands on the reels, it ‘sticks’ in set and resets the spin counter back to three. The round continues until you run out of spins, at which repoint all the collected symbols are added up and paid out. The most exciting aspect of Hold & Win is the potential to fill the total screen with symbols, which often triggers the game’s best jackpot. Many games in this category offer a progressive jackpot or a frozen grand prize that can be won if you care to fill every position on the grid. For example, a popular game might have a five-by-three control grid, and if you land fifteen coin symbols, you win the grand jackpot. This mechanic is highly engaging because it combines the thrill of a chase with the satisfaction of seeing your profits accumulate on screen. It also tends to appeal to players who enjoy a more straightforward, yet rewarding, bonus experience. In New Zealand, you can find Hold & Win games in many online casinos that are properly licensed, and they are often among the most played titles due to their high volatility and the potential for large payouts. When playing a Hold & Win slot, it’s important to understand the different types of symbols that can appear. Some symbols might offer a fixed cash value, while others might have a multiplier attached, and there are often special symbols that can trigger additional prizes, such as free spins or a mini-game. The key strategy is to keep an eye on the spin counter and hope that you land sufficiency symbols to keep the round alive. While the feature is largely based on luck, the anticipation of each spin is what makes it so captivating. For those who enjoy a commixture of skill and chance, Hold & Win is a great option, and it’s a mechanic that has been refined over the years to supply more variety and higher potential wins.
Cluster Pays and Cascading Symbols: A Fresh Take on Payouts
Cluster Pays is a mechanic that completely changes the way you win on a slot. Instead of traditional paylines, where symbols need to seem on specific lines from left wing to right hand, Cluster Pays rewards you for landing groups of matching symbols that tinge horizontally or vertically. Typically, a cluster of five or more symbols will trigger a win, and the cluster is then removed from the storage-battery grid, allowing recent symbols to fall into place. This is where cascading symbols amount into play. When you land a winning cluster, the symbols disappear, and new symbols cascade down from above, filling the empty spaces. If these new symbols create another winning cluster, the process repeats, and you can potentially chain multiple wins from a single spin. This mechanic is often combined with increasing multipliers, so for each one sequential cascade in a single spin may multiply your winnings by a higher factor. For example, the first of all win might be multiplied by one, the second by two, the third by three, and so on, up to a certain demarcation line. This can lead to some truly massive payouts from a single bet, especially if you manage to trigger a long chain of cascade mountains. Games that apply Cluster Pays often get a gridiron that is not the standard five-by-three layout; it mightiness be a seven-by-seven grid, or even an unusual mold, which adds to the visual appeal and the strategic depth. For New Zealand players, Cluster Pays slots are a fantastic way to experience something different from the standard payline structure. The mechanic is particularly popular in games that feature a stone or jewel theme, but you’ll also come across it in adventures and fantasy settings. One of the key advantages of Cluster Pays is that it can create sir thomas more frequent winning opportunities, as the cascading effect can generate multiple wins from a single spin. However, the volatility can be high, so it’s important to manage your bankroll accordingly. When you play a Cluster Pays game, you should always check the help section to understand the exact cluster size required and how the multiplier deeds, as these details can variegate significantly. Some games power require a cluster of six or seven symbols, while others might have a minimum of four. The cascading mechanic also often triggers a bonus feature when you clear the entire grid, which can lead to a immense payout.

What are Megaways slots and how do they work?
Megaways slots utilize a random reel modifier to change the number of symbols on each reel per spin, offering up to 117,649 ways to win. This dynamic mechanic creates unpredictable paylines, increasing excitement and win potential.
What is a Hold & Win feature in slot games?
Hold & Win is a bonus round where specific symbols lock in place while you re-spin the remaining reels, collecting values or jackpot symbols. The round ends when no new symbols land, and you win the sum of all held symbols.
How do Cluster Pays slots differ from traditional paylines?
Cluster Pays slots laurels wins when groups of matching symbols jot horizontally or vertically, forming clusters of a minimum size of it. Unlike traditional paylines, cluster wins disappear and are replaced by new symbols, potentially creating chain reactions for multiple wins.
What is a Bonus Buy feature and should I use it?
Bonus Buy allows you to pay a fixed multiple of your bet to instantly trigger a slot’s bonus round without waiting for scatter symbols. It offers straightaway access to high-volatility features but can deplete your funds quickly, so employ it sparingly.
What are cascading symbols and expanding reels in slots?
Cascading symbols remove winning combinations, allowing new symbols to fall into place for consecutive wins. Expanding reels increase the number of symbols or rows during a bonus feature, boosting win ways and potential payouts.
